Subject: [PATCH 2/2] mtd: drop ceiva map driver
Date: Fri, 03 Jun 2011 18:49:19 +0300	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1307116159.3069.22.camel@localhost>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1307015648-17505-2-git-send-email-dbaryshkov@gmail.com>

On Thu, 2011-06-02 at 15:54 +0400, Dmitry Eremin-Solenikov wrote:
> The same functionality is provided by physmap flash driver,
> drivers/mtd/maps/ceiva.c didn't receive any functional changes since
> the start of current git history, so drop it.
> 
> Signed-off-by: Dmitry Eremin-Solenikov <dbaryshkov@gmail.com>

How about this: I take this patch to l2-mtd-2.6, but not taking the
first patch. If someone complains that he needs ceiva, we'll add you
first patch. Otherwise, you should kill all the other ceiva bits. Is
this OK?
